Result of Service - Output 1: Technical document evidencing the methodology to be implemented for the collection of data to show the progress and/or scope achieved by the Integral Urban Revitalization Plans. One (1) month from the start of activities.

  • Output 2. Document that contains an analysis of the results and components developed in the various Integral Urban Revitalization Plans carried out by the District Secretariat of Habitat, focusing in this case, on the understanding of the programs from a sustainability perspective around the housing components. The document should include:

7. Analysis of the existing housing components in the territories, showing those structural weaknesses and shortcomings in key elements of morphology and sustainability. 8. Analysis of the urban environments in which the residential units included in the PIRs have been developed, showing the general weaknesses present. 9. Determine the progress and current status of the Urban Revitalization Plans from a housing and sustainability perspective. 10. Analysis of the progress achieved by the PIRs, demonstrating or pointing out what changes have been implemented with respect to the previous existing conditions. 11. Analysis of what has been achieved so far with respect to the objectives set by the Secretary of Habitat in relation to the housing components. 12. Analysis of the main characteristics in which the selected settlements have been developed, including the general elements that make up the dwellings, together with their initial architectural characteristics. Four (4) months from the start of activities.

  • Output 3. Document with methodological guidelines for the promotion of the Integral Urban Revitalization Plans, including the development of conclusions and results that allow for a better execution and management of the same. The document should include:

7. Results achieved by the PIRs from the housing and constructive sustainability components, 8. Conclusions regarding the objectives achieved and the existing problems in the execution of the programs. 9. Structural elements in terms of housing and sustainable housing that should be incorporated into the programs in order to increase their scope and success. 10. Guidelines for the implementation of the proposed recommendations from the financial and chronological components. 11. Recommendations that include innovation components from a New Urban Agenda and Sustainable Development Goals perspective. 12. Guidelines for the methodological consolidation of the Plans from the perspective of the housing components that will allow easy replication of the program in other territories of the District. Six (6) months from the start of activities.
